If you put your onions in the fridge, and only take them out right before cutting them, it helps so much. :D
Also, if you don't have time, the freezer for ~30 minutes will help as well, and make it so you're eyes don't water too much. :)
/I work at a place where we have to cut onions, fridging them helps a lot. :)
